Frequently Asked Questions About Rush Dresses
What fabric is best for rush dresses? Lightweight, breathable fabrics like linen, cotton, and viscose are ideal for rush dresses because they keep you cool and comfortable in the heat. Avoid heavy materials like denim or thick polyester, which can make you feel overheated.
How do I style a rush dress for a night out? The key to styling a rush dress for a night out is to add statement accessories. Swap in strappy heels, a clutch, and bold jewelry to elevate the look. A denim jacket or blazer can also dress it up if needed.
Can I wear a rush dress to the office? Absolutely! Opt for a shirtdress, shirtwaist, or midi style in a neutral color like navy or black. Pair it with loafers or heels and a blazer for a polished office look that still feels comfortable.
How do I care for my rush dress to make it last? Most rush dresses are machine-washable, but always check the care label first. Hang or lay flat to dry to avoid shrinking, and store it in a cool, dry place to keep it looking fresh.
